Reactions of hydroperoxides with iron(III) porphyrins: Heterolytic cleavage followed by hydroperoxide oxidation
1998
Abstract Reaction of α,α-dimethylphenethyl hydroperoxide with iron(III) tetramesitylporphyrin in protic solvent gives alkoxy-radical products and little epoxide. Such observations are usually interpreted as evidence for homolysis of the OO bond in the catalytic process. Yet the same products are now obtained under similar conditions from the reaction of this hydroperoxide with the high-valent oxene (Fe + O), generated unambiguously. Therefore such products are not necessarily evidence for homolysis but are consistent with heterolysis. Nevertheless, the solvent can affect the nature of O-O cleavage.
